Rosemarie Hartnett is Awarded the Crystal Compass Award by the International Franchise Association

Rosemarie Hartnett was honored at the International Franchise Association Convention in Orlando Florida with the Crystal Compass Award citing her many contributions to franchising and her outstanding leadership ability. The award is presented each year by the IFA Women’s Committee. The recipient is chosen from a wide selection of franchising executives including both men and women. Hartnett...

Abrakadoodle’s Co-Creators Participate in Franchising Gives Back

Abrakadoodle’s co-creators Mary Rogers and Rosemarie Hartnett participated in the International Franchise Association’s first Franchising Gives Back event at the Orlando Heath and Rehabilitation Center. There franchising executives built gardens, created outdoor seating, repaired walkways and even built wheel chair height raised gardens. Rogers and Hartnett visited with the...
